[v1,2/3] RISC-V: Split "(a & (1UL << bitno)) ? 0 : -1" to bext + addi

For a straightforward application of bext for the following function
        long bext64(long a, char bitno)
        {
          return (a & (1UL << bitno)) ? 0 : -1;
        }
we generate
	srl	a0,a0,a1	# 7	[c=4 l=4]  lshrdi3
	andi	a0,a0,1	# 8	[c=4 l=4]  anddi3/1
	addi	a0,a0,-1	# 14	[c=4 l=4]  adddi3/1
due to the following failed match at combine time:
        (set (reg:DI 82)
             (zero_extract:DI (reg:DI 83)
                  (const_int 1 [0x1])
                  (reg:DI 84)))

The existing pattern for bext requires the 3rd argument to
zero_extract to be a QImode register wrapped in a zero_extension.
This adds an additional pattern that allows an Xmode argument.

With this change, the testcase compiles to
	bext	a0,a0,a1	# 8	[c=4 l=4]  *bextdi
	addi	a0,a0,-1	# 14	[c=4 l=4]  adddi3/1

gcc/ChangeLog:

	* config/riscv/bitmanip.md (*bext<mode>): Add an additional
	pattern that allows the 3rd argument to zero_extract to be
	an Xmode register operand.

gcc/testsuite/ChangeLog:

	* gcc.target/riscv/zbs-bext.c: Add testcases.
	* gcc.target/riscv/zbs-bexti.c: Add testcases.

diff --git a/gcc/config/riscv/bitmanip.md b/gcc/config/riscv/bitmanip.md
index ea5dea13cfb..5d7c20e9fdc 100644
--- a/gcc/config/riscv/bitmanip.md
+++ b/gcc/config/riscv/bitmanip.md
@@ -332,6 +332,18 @@  (define_insn "*bext<mode>"
   "bext\t%0,%1,%2"
   [(set_attr "type" "bitmanip")])
 
+;; When performing `(a & (1UL << bitno)) ? 0 : -1` the combiner
+;; usually has the `bitno` typed as X-mode (i.e. no further
+;; zero-extension is performed around the bitno).
+(define_insn "*bext<mode>"
+  [(set (match_operand:X 0 "register_operand" "=r")
+	(zero_extract:X (match_operand:X 1 "register_operand" "r")
+			(const_int 1)
+			(match_operand:X 2 "register_operand" "r")))]
+  "TARGET_ZBS"
+  "bext\t%0,%1,%2"
+  [(set_attr "type" "bitmanip")])
+
